Terazosin Hydrochloride A Comprehensive Overview of Its Manufacturing


Terazosin hydrochloride, identified by its CAS number 2063074-08-8, is an essential pharmaceutical compound primarily employed in the treatment of benign prostatic hyperplasia (BPH) and hypertension. As a selective alpha-1 adrenergic antagonist, terazosin facilitates the relaxation of smooth muscles in the bladder neck and prostate, resulting in improved urine flow and a reduction in blood pressure. The significance of this compound in medical applications has led to a high demand for its production and distribution, making it imperative to understand the intricacies of its manufacturing.


The manufacturing of terazosin hydrochloride involves several critical stages, including formulation development, synthesis, purification, and quality control. Initially, the synthesis of terazosin begins with the appropriate selection of raw materials and reagents. Typically, the process incorporates a multi-step synthesis involving cyclization reactions, substitution reactions, and the introduction of various functional groups. The exact synthetic pathway may vary depending on the manufacturer, with some methods utilizing environmentally friendly approaches to minimize waste and improve overall yield.


Post-synthesis, the compound undergoes purification processes to remove any unreacted starting materials, by-products, and solvents. Common purification techniques include crystallization and chromatography, which are essential to ensure the production of a high-purity final product. The purity of terazosin hydrochloride is of utmost importance, as impurities can compromise its efficacy and safety in therapeutic applications.

Quality control is a vital aspect of the manufacturing process. Manufacturers must adhere to stringent regulatory standards set forth by authorities such as the U.S. Food and Drug Administration (FDA) and the European Medicines Agency (EMA). Rigorous testing is conducted at various stages of production, including raw material testing, in-process controls, and final product evaluation. Parameters such as potency, purity, and stability are regularly assessed using advanced analytical techniques like high-performance liquid chromatography (HPLC) and mass spectrometry.


Furthermore, the importance of raw material sourcing cannot be overstated. Reputable manufacturers prioritize the use of high-quality, pharmaceutical-grade ingredients to maintain the integrity of their products. Long-term relationships with reliable suppliers help ensure consistent quality and availability of raw materials.
